This is held once a year to Support our green belt along the length of the Braamfontein Spruit. Field & Study Park is the biggest area along it and is the most priceless green lung so close to our Sandton CBD.
Friends of Field & Study – FOFS – our motto is “To protect, promote and preserve “ the Park – and we have been doing this for almost 10 years now.
Although the day was promoted by the Parkmore Resident’s Assoc. it is very disappointing to see just how few really care enough to come out and “do their bit” for the Park. We always need help. Had it not been for Julien Ortlepp, Chairman of the PCA with his truck and workers and a truck and team from Parks Depot 406 to plant the 20 trees we had dug the holes for, as well as a tanker to water them, we would have been lost.
We oiled the Jungle Gym, installed two new swing dustbins, painted the car and metal picnic table, did a river clean up and picked up litter. Today – Mon. 21st Parks have dug a further 23 holes and will be planting the new trees tomorrow.
